Output 12fb910343a456822289ae2b91715e00ba7848ca417bc831bdbb8de5e51b1b76:2

value
595369
script pubkey
OP_0 OP_PUSHBYTES_20 59cb518bf52d7bfda47f545818e506f37c41f48b
address
bc1qt894rzl494almfrl23vp3egx7d7yraytzdxwyl
transaction
12fb910343a456822289ae2b91715e00ba7848ca417bc831bdbb8de5e51b1b76
spent
true